Exclamation ~TSS~ you asked for them... Steel CJ Grills!

just finished these up. customers have been asking for these for years.
There 1/16" Steel CJ Grills that fit the HPI Rubicon body. i spent a LOT of time making sure every dimension is true to the full size grill, and these things are perfect. Very limited Run.

$31 shipped($US)




here you can see it laying over an aluminum TJ grill. note that it is longer and narrower at the bottom like the full scale.
